软件课程可以帮助您学习 Python、Java 和 JavaScript 等编程语言,以及算法、数据结构和软件开发方法等概念。您可以掌握版本控制、Debugging 和测试方面的技能,这些技能对于创建可靠的应用程序至关重要。许多课程会介绍用于协作的 Git 等工具、用于编码的 Integrated Development Environment (IDE) 以及用于构建用户界面和 Backend 系统的 React 或 Django 等框架。

您将获得的技能: Process Mapping, Business Process Modeling, Business Analysis, Cloud-Native Computing, Data Migration, Software Architecture, Stakeholder Analysis, Systems Design, Extract, Transform, Load, Systems Architecture, Communication Planning, Stakeholder Management, Data Integration, Network Security, Test Planning, Cybersecurity, Enterprise Architecture, Software Testing, Project Management, Information Technology
初级 · 专业证书 · 3-6 个月

DeepLearning.AI
您将获得的技能: Prompt Engineering, Large Language Modeling, Database Design, LLM Application, Software Documentation, Software Design Patterns, Collaborative Software, Software Testing, OpenAI API, Application Design, Generative AI, Database Management, AI Enablement, Code Review, Software Architecture, System Design and Implementation, Dependency Analysis, Software Engineering, Software Development, Machine Learning
初级 · 专业证书 · 1-3 个月

您将获得的技能: Ansible, Configuration Management, Chef (Configuration Management Tool), Infrastructure as Code (IaC)
初级 · 课程 · 1-4 周

您将获得的技能: Threat Modeling, Application Security, Open Web Application Security Project (OWASP), Secure Coding, Authentications, OAuth, Development Testing, Software Development Life Cycle, Unified Modeling Language, Authorization (Computing), Single Sign-On (SSO), Software Development, Security Software, Vulnerability Assessments, Data Validation, Cyber Security Assessment, Cyber Security Strategy, Cybersecurity, Role-Based Access Control (RBAC)
中级 · 课程 · 3-6 个月

您将获得的技能: Test Planning, Software Testing, Debugging, Test Case, Issue Tracking, Functional Testing, Unit Testing, Software Quality Assurance, System Testing, Test Tools, Acceptance Testing, Integration Testing, Test Driven Development (TDD), Test Automation, Regression Testing, Quality Assurance, Waterfall Methodology, Agile Methodology, Python Programming
初级 · 课程 · 1-4 周

您将获得的技能: Data Storytelling, Rmarkdown, Data Literacy, Data Visualization, Data Presentation, Data Ethics, Data Cleansing, Data Validation, Ggplot2, R (Software), Tableau Software, Sampling (Statistics), Presentations, Spreadsheet Software, Data Analysis, LinkedIn, Object Oriented Programming (OOP), Data Structures, Interviewing Skills, Applicant Tracking Systems
攻读学位
初级 · 专业证书 · 3-6 个月

Intuit
您将获得的技能: 分类账(会计), 道德标准与行为, 事务处理, 会计, 收益表, 簿记, 资产负债表, 财务报表, 会计软件, 现金流量, 一般会计
初级 · 课程 · 1-3 个月

University of Michigan
您将获得的技能: Python 编程, 数据可视化软件, 调试, 计算机编程, 关系数据库, 数据分析, 数据库, JSON, 数据库设计, 数据清理, 恢复性应用程序接口, 网络抓取, 数据处理, 交互式数据可视化, 查询语言, 数据结构, 可扩展标记语言(XML), 编程原则, 网络服务, 数据可视化
攻读学位
初级 · 专项课程 · 3-6 个月

IBM
您将获得的技能: 云基础设施, 集装箱化, 微服务, 云部署, 版本控制, Kubernetes, Node.JS, 网络开发, JavaScript 框架, 云服务, 无服务器计算, DevOps, 云计算, 后端网站开发, 全栈式网络开发, 应用框架, 网络应用, CI/CD, OpenShift, 软件开发
中级 · 课程 · 1-4 周

Meta
您将获得的技能: 利纳克斯, Unix 命令, 文件管理, 命令行界面, GitHub, 协作软件, 版本控制, Git(版本控制系统), 网络开发, 软件版本控制, Linux 命令, 软件开发, 软件开发工具
初级 · 课程 · 1-4 周
University of Alberta
您将获得的技能: Agile Software Development, Requirements Management, Software Development, Product Management, Process Development, Application Lifecycle Management, Software Engineering, Project Planning, Project Management, Customer Engagement
混合 · 课程 · 1-4 周
University of Alberta
您将获得的技能: 敏捷方法, 项目规划, 项目管理, 需求管理, 产品管理, 软件工程, 敏捷软件开发, 工艺开发, 需求分析, 软件开发
混合 · 课程 · 1-4 周